Information Security Policy
The fundamental objective of Inercia Digital’s Information Security Management System is the protection of information, offering its staff, clients, and providers a secure working environment through appropriate security measures and operational processes.
The principles of our information security policy are:
- The principles of our information security policy are:
- Integrity: The information will at all times be complete, accurate, valid, and free from manipulation.
- Availability: The information will always be accessible by authorised persons at all times, and its persistence will be guaranteed in the face of any eventuality.
At Inercia Digital, we are aware that our training and innovation services require appropriate protection and management in order to ensure the continuity of our services and to minimise potential damage caused by failures in information security.
To this end, we undertake the following commitments:
- The permanent commitment of Inercia Digital regarding information security management will be demonstrated through training and awareness programmes that promote participatory management in these areas, enabling staff skills to be used for the continuous improvement of both the production process and security.
- To guarantee the development of our activities within the applicable regulations and standards, compliance will be given to the legislation and regulations in force, as well as to other requirements signed with our clients, including those referring to information security and data protection.
- To comply with the requirements and continuously improve the effectiveness of the Information Security Management System, through the implementation of measurement and monitoring systems for services, as well as security objectives.
- To conduct and periodically review a risk analysis based on recognised methods that allow us to establish the level of information security and minimise risks through the development of specific policies, technical solutions, and contractual agreements with specialised organisations.
- Inercia Digital staff will carry out their work oriented towards achieving the set objectives and in accordance, at all times, with legal requirements, as well as those of the client.
- Selection of staff, providers, and subcontractors based on information security criteria.
- Any incident or weakness that may compromise or has compromised the confidentiality, integrity, and/or availability of the information will be recorded and analysed to apply the corresponding corrective and/or preventive measures. Likewise, they will be communicated to the interested parties within the corresponding timeframes.
